UFC Fight Night: Dern vs Hill is the focus of this weekend's MMA DFS picks and UFC daily fantasy lineups. The UFC Vegas 73 fight card kicks off with the Early Prelims at 4:00 PM ET on ESPN+, followed by the Main Card on ESPN+ at 7:00 ET. Our Main Event this week highlights BJJ Ace Mackenzie Dern against the high-volume striker Angela Hill. This Dern vs Hill UFC matchup feels like a throwback to the early days of MMA where fighters entered the cage as specialists in their martial art. Dern is coming off a tough decision loss against top-five contender Yan Xiaonan. Dern is a face the UFC has been pushing for a few years, so I'm not shocked she is headlining a card, but with that said this isn't your normal headlining fight. Dern is the rightful favorite here, and she has a huge advantage in terms of submission skills but she's going to be behind if she can't close the distance in this matchup. Hill throws more volume, is more active, and isn't afraid to bite down on the mouthpiece to trade shots with anyone in the division. For cash games, this fight can be stacked as it's likely to play out over 5 rounds in which case both fighters should score pretty well. Dern is the more likely of the two to find the submission victory but at $9100 she isn't a lock to make it onto the optimal lineup in a win. I'll have both fighters in my GPP lineups, but I'll be leaning more toward Hill because if she does win it probably comes with 125+ strikes landed and a score well above 80 at only $7100.

The "safest" play on the slate, but you are paying a ton for it. Silva is much better in this matchup, with her line swelling all the way to -1000 but her inside distance only sits at -150. Silva doesn't have elite volume, she doesn't chain wrestle for takedowns, so despite her being safe to win she isn't a fighter where a win guarantees a massive DraftKings score. I'll have some Silva in my lineups but because of how expensive she is, she isn't going to be one of my highest-owned fighters.

Hernandez has a tough task ahead of him in Shahbazyan, but "Fluffy" is always game for a fight. This matchup is going to be really hard for Hernandez in the first five minutes when Edmen is fresh, but if he survives, he grinds out a stoppage by the end of the fight. I'll be playing both sides of this fight for tournaments because both of them push to wrestle and are opportunistic when it comes to finding submissions. With how strong of a fighter Edmen is early on in fights, I'm opting for someone else in cash games at this price.

Buckley is taking his shot at a new weight class, and I think this is a perfect matchup for him. We've seen Buckley wrestle effectively when he wants to use it and, in this matchup, he has the advantage when it comes to the ground game, but where I think, he is really going to shine is striking. Fialho is tough, but he doesn't move much in the cage so he should be a sitting duck for the bombs that Buckley throws. As long as the weight cut isn't too hard on him coming down to 170 lbsthe  from 185, he should be able to add a highlight reel performance to his resume in this fight.

This is the first time Borchschev is matched up with someone who isn’t going to try to wrestle him, so I'm excited to see his striking on full display. Where I think Borchschev is going to stand out is in his ability to judge distance here. Maheshate is going to wing wild punches, but he's landing strikes at under 30% during his time in the UFC which shows just how inaccurate he can be in the cage. Borchschev is more technical and eventually finds the KO shot here.

Nascimento could win this fight, but I'm just not playing Ilir Latifi fights anymore on DraftKings. It's a heavyweight fight so they normally get some decent ownership due to finishing ability, but the way that Latifi fights just drains the scoring chances. Latifi has a career 100% takedown defense and gives up 2.75 strikes per minute on average so unless Nascimento is going to KO him (which has happened twice since 2014) it's going to be hard for Nascimento to score the 100pts he is going to need at his $9000 price tag.

This fight should be tightly contested and Cosce is giving up length in this matchup, but I think he really shines with his wrestling. Why Cosce makes for a great play is how consistent he is in his game plan. He's going to push to either control against the cage or get a takedown and if he gets it there, he's shown he has the ability to keep guys pinned down racking up an average of 3 minutes of control time per round in his last couple of fights. Urbina has size and he also likes to get the fight to the ground so maybe he ends up being the better grappler, but it's hard to trust someone who hasn't won a professional fight since 2019 (he won an exhibition match on "The Ultimate Fighter" against a short notice replacement in 2021).

Karolina is the better striker and has a five-inch reach advantage here, so I expect her to get the job done as long as she fights a smart game plan. My issue is she had the same exact path of victory against Jessica Penne and instead of keeping it standing, she decided to dive headfirst into a submission. I'm considering Karolina for cash games, but if she fights a smart game plan and just stays at range her most likely outcome is a decision win where she scores only 75-80pts.

This is a classic wrestler vs striker matchup here. The biggest advantage in this fight is if Godinez gets a takedown, I don't think Ducote is going to be able to get back up, but for her UFC career Ducote has stopped all 8 of the takedowns that were shot at her. Godinez has shown that if she is having success with wrestling, she has no problem going back to it over and over again as she showed in her fight against Carnelosi where she scored 8 of them, and against Lookboome where she scored 5. The problem is if the takedowns don't come easy early on, she abandons them. Against Angela Hill, she needed to find them to win the fight and she only attempted one per round, and against Calvillo, she only attempted two total. I'm leaning towards Godinez because of her upside if her wrestling is sharp come Saturday Night, and I'll be overweight to the field in terms of my GPP ownership.

A true pick'em fight, but I'm going to lean toward who I think is the better striker in this matchup. Sato has power and finishing ability, averaging 90+ pts in his wins in the UFC but the promotion hasn't done him any favors in terms of matchups. His second fight in the UFC was against Belal Mohammad, and he recently fought borderline top 15 fighters in Gunni Nelson and up-and-comer Bryan Battle, so this is a major step back in competition for him. Gorimbo can wrestle and has a better submission skill set than Sato, but if this fight doesn't get on the ground Sato is going to knock him out.

Fiore welcomes Hooper up to the 155 lb. division in a fight that I don't think anyone expected to be made. Fiore is going to out-box him on the feet, so Hooper is submission or bust in this matchup, but my real concern is the strength disparity. Hooper was outmuscled consistently at 145lbs and wasn't able to get his fights to the ground so going up a weight class, I'm not sure how he is expected to succeed. I'll have Fiore and a bet on Fiore by KO, and as long as this fight doesn't end up on the ground early, I think it's pretty one-sided.

Do I think Shahbazyan wins this week if I had to pick the winner of this fight, no. Do I think if he wins this fight, he hits the optimal lineup...100%. Edmen can wrestle, he can strike, and for the first five minutes of his fights, he looks like the best fighter in the cage. In his matchup against Hermanson, he won round 1, but after that point, he was taken down 3 times and outstruck 123-16 in terms of total strikes landed. He's first round or bust, but at $6800 he's worth the shot. As a cash game punt play, he's interesting because he isn't likely to go all three rounds in a loss, but he should still get you 20+ pts even if he ends up losing in the second round. He will be my highest-owned fighter from the pay-downs outside of Hill.

The biggest underdog on the card and for good reason, Leonardo doesn't possess enough resistance standing or wrestling to pose a serious threat. Her best chance at victory would be if they clinch up, a scramble ensues, and she ends up in top position in the first round. If that happens there is a chance she works enough and tires out Silva to find the victory, but from everything I've seen, especially in her last fight against Mandy Bohm, she probably gets outworked in this matchup.
